阿里云服务器怎么建网站链接,阿里云服务器搭建网站全攻略,从入门到精通
- 综合资讯
- 2024-12-05 18:01:15
- 2

阿里云服务器搭建网站攻略,从入门到精通,详细介绍如何使用阿里云服务器建立网站链接,涵盖基础设置、环境搭建、网站部署等步骤,助您轻松掌握网站建设技巧。...
阿里云服务器搭建网站攻略,从入门到精通,详细介绍如何使用阿里云服务器建立网站链接,涵盖基础设置、环境搭建、网站部署等步骤,助您轻松掌握网站建设技巧。
https://www.example.com/aliyun-server-website-building-guide
随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,而阿里云作为国内领先的云计算服务商,提供了丰富的云服务器资源,为网站搭建提供了强大的支持,本文将为您详细讲解如何在阿里云服务器上搭建网站,从入门到精通。
准备工作
1、阿里云账号:您需要注册一个阿里云账号,登录阿里云官网(https://www.aliyun.com/),点击“免费注册”,按照提示完成注册。
2、购买云服务器:登录阿里云账号,进入“产品”页面,选择“弹性计算”下的“ECS云服务器”,根据您的需求选择合适的云服务器配置,并完成购买。
3、准备域名:购买云服务器后,您需要为网站准备一个域名,您可以选择在阿里云购买域名,也可以在其它域名服务商处购买。
4、域名解析:将购买的域名解析到阿里云服务器,登录阿里云账号,进入“产品”页面,选择“域名”下的“域名解析”,添加解析记录,将域名解析到云服务器的公网IP地址。
网站环境搭建
1、安装Linux操作系统:阿里云云服务器默认安装的是Linux操作系统,您可以根据需要选择安装不同的Linux发行版,如CentOS、Ubuntu等。
2、安装Apache/Nginx:Apache和Nginx是目前最流行的Web服务器软件,您可以根据个人喜好选择安装其中之一。
(1)安装Apache:登录云服务器,执行以下命令安装Apache:
sudo yum install httpd -y
安装完成后,启动Apache服务:
sudo systemctl start httpd
设置Apache服务开机自启:
sudo systemctl enable httpd
(2)安装Nginx:登录云服务器,执行以下命令安装Nginx:
sudo yum install nginx -y
安装完成后,启动Nginx服务:
sudo systemctl start nginx
设置Nginx服务开机自启:
sudo systemctl enable nginx
3、安装PHP:PHP是一种流行的服务器端脚本语言,您需要为网站安装PHP环境。
(1)安装PHP:登录云服务器,执行以下命令安装PHP:
sudo yum install php -y
(2)安装PHP模块:根据您的需求,安装相应的PHP模块,如MySQL、Redis、Memcached等,以下以安装MySQL模块为例:
sudo yum install php-mysql -y
4、安装数据库:MySQL是一种流行的开源数据库,您需要为网站安装MySQL数据库。
(1)安装MySQL:登录云服务器,执行以下命令安装MySQL:
sudo yum install mysql-community-server -y
(2)配置MySQL:安装完成后,初始化MySQL数据库,设置root密码等。
sudo mysqld_safe --user=mysql & sudo mysql_secure_installation
网站部署
1、将网站文件上传到云服务器:您可以使用FTP、SFTP、SCP等方式将网站文件上传到云服务器上的指定目录。
2、配置Web服务器:根据您的需求,配置Apache或Nginx的虚拟主机文件,将域名指向网站文件所在的目录。
(1)配置Apache虚拟主机:
sudo nano /etc/httpd/conf/httpd.conf
找到以下内容:
#ServerName www.example.com:80 #ServerAlias www.example.com
修改为:
ServerName www.example.com ServerAlias www.example.com
保存并退出编辑。
(2)配置Nginx虚拟主机:
sudo nano /etc/nginx/nginx.conf
找到以下内容:
#user nginx; #worker_processes auto;
修改为:
user nginx; worker_processes auto;
保存并退出编辑。
3、重启Web服务器:重启Apache或Nginx服务,使配置生效。
sudo systemctl restart httpd
或
sudo systemctl restart nginx
网站测试
1、在浏览器中输入您的域名,如果能够正常访问网站,则说明网站搭建成功。
2、对网站进行测试,确保功能正常运行。
通过以上步骤,您已经成功在阿里云服务器上搭建了一个网站,在实际应用中,您可能需要根据需求进行更多配置,如优化网站性能、设置缓存、安全防护等,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/1342806.html
发表评论